Ingredients for Caribbean Coconut Curry Salmon
Essential ingredients for the dish
To create a mouthwatering Caribbean Coconut Curry Salmon, start with these essential ingredients:
- Salmon fillets: Fresh or frozen, but ensure they’re thick-cut to hold up during cooking.
- Coconut milk: Full-fat coconut milk adds a creamy texture and rich flavor, essential for that tropical kick.
- Curry powder: A blend of spices, preferably with a hint of heat, to bring warmth and depth to your dish.
- Turmeric: Not only does it add color, but its earthiness complements the curry well.
- Garlic and ginger: Freshly minced brings a robust flavor that pairs beautifully with salmon.
- Vegetables: Bell peppers and spinach are perfect for adding color, texture, and nutrition.
Optional flavor boosters
Want to take your Caribbean Coconut Curry Salmon to the next level? Consider these optional flavor boosters:
- Lime juice: A splash at the end brightens the dish wonderfully.
- Fresh cilantro: Chopped and sprinkled on top adds freshness and a hint of herbal notes.
- Chili peppers: For those who enjoy a little extra heat, fresh or dried chili can elevate the flavor profile.

Step-by-Step Preparation of Caribbean Coconut Curry Salmon
Creating a vibrant Caribbean Coconut Curry Salmon dish is not just about following steps; it’s an experience filled with colorful ingredients and captivating aromas. Let’s dive into the step-by-step preparation process that will take your weeknight dinner to a tropical getaway.
Prep and season the salmon
Start with fresh salmon fillets—ideally, choose sustainably sourced fish, like those certified by the Marine Stewardship Council. You’ll need about four fillets, each weighing around six ounces. Begin by patting them dry with a paper towel; this is key to achieving that delightful sear we’re going for.
Next, season the salmon generously with salt and pepper. If you’re feeling a little adventurous, a sprinkle of paprika or cayenne can add an intriguing kick. Remember, a little bit of seasoning goes a long way in enhancing the flavors, and salmon has a delightful richness that pairs well with spices.
Sear the salmon fillets
Once your salmon is seasoned, it’s time to bring out that caramelization. Heat a bit of coconut oil in a non-stick skillet over medium-high heat. Coconut oil not only complements the tropical flavors of your dish but also has a high smoke point, making it perfect for searing.
Carefully lay the salmon fillets in the hot skillet, skin-side down if applicable, and let them cook undisturbed for about 4 minutes—resist the temptation to move them around! Flip the fillets carefully and cook for an additional 2-3 minutes on the other side until they’re beautifully golden brown. Once done, remove them from the skillet and set aside; we’ll return to them shortly.
Bloom the curry spices
This is where the magic of Caribbean Coconut Curry Salmon truly begins! In the same skillet, reduce the heat to medium and add your choice of curry powder—about one tablespoon works great here. You can also blend in a teaspoon of ground ginger and turmeric for a more complex flavor profile. Blooming these spices in the residual heat of the skillet helps release their essential oils, enhancing their impact.
Sauté the aromatics
Now it’s time to build the aromatic foundation of your sauce. Add a medium-sized onion, finely chopped, and sauté it until it becomes translucent. The scent of sizzling onions mingling with curry will transport you straight to the Caribbean! After about 2-3 minutes, toss in minced garlic and fresh ginger (if you haven’t used ground) and cook for another minute—don’t allow them to burn, as we want a mellow, fragrant undertone.
Create the coconut curry sauce
Next, pour in a can (about 14 ounces) of full-fat coconut milk into the skillet. The rich creaminess will create a lovely base for your curry sauce. Stir to combine all the ingredients and allow it to simmer gently for about 5 minutes. You can add a touch of lime juice for brightness and even a spoonful of brown sugar to balance the flavors. Taste it—does it need more seasoning?
Cook the salmon in the sauce
Now for the final flourish! Gently nestle the seared salmon fillets back into the coconut curry sauce, spooning some of the sauce over the top. Simmer for about 5 more minutes on low heat, just enough to allow the salmon to finish cooking through without becoming dry.
You’ll know it’s ready when the salmon flakes easily with a fork, soaking up the wonderful coconut and curry flavors. Serve this delightful dish over a bed of fluffy rice or quinoa to soak up all the sumptuous sauce.

Vegetarian Coconut Curry Option
Transforming your Caribbean coconut curry into a vegetarian delight is easier than you think! Swap salmon for hearty veggies like:
- Chickpeas – Packed with protein and hearty enough to satisfy even the most dedicated carnivores.
- Eggplant – Absorbs the delicious coconut curry flavors beautifully.
- Tofu or Tempeh – These are fantastic meat substitutes that soak up the warm spices exceptionally well. Consider browning them first for texture.
Simply follow the original coconut curry recipe, substituting the salmon for your chosen veggies. For additional texture and nutrition, toss in some spinach or kale right before serving. This not only adds vibrant color but also elevates the health factor. If you’re interested in more vegetarian tips, sites like Forks Over Knives offer plenty of inspiration!
Spicy Variations with More Peppers
Craving an extra kick? Add more heat with different types of peppers. Try incorporating:
- Jalapeños – Fresh or pickled, they enhance the flavors while adding a nice heat.
- Scotch Bonnet or habanero – Traditional favorites in Caribbean cooking, they’re perfect for those who appreciate fiery dishes.
When adding heat, start small and adjust to your taste preferences. A good rule of thumb? Chop a little, taste, and add more if needed. Selecting the Right Type of Salmon
When preparing your Caribbean Coconut Curry Salmon, choosing the right salmon is crucial. Look for wild-caught salmon whenever possible, as it tends to have a richer flavor and firmer texture. Varieties like sockeye or king salmon not only taste fantastic, but they’re also packed with omega-3 fatty acids, making them a healthier choice. If you prefer a milder flavor, farmed salmon can work well too, but be sure to check for sustainability labels to ensure you’re making an eco-friendly decision.
Importance of Simmering the Sauce
Simmering the sauce is another key step that shouldn’t be overlooked. Not only does it allow the flavors of the coconut milk and spices to meld beautifully, but it also helps tenderize the salmon as it cooks. Aim for a gentle simmer—about 10 minutes will let those enticing flavors deepen without overcooking the fish. Stir occasionally and feel free to taste along the way! Adjust seasonings if needed; after all, cooking should be about personal preference.

FAQs about Caribbean Coconut Curry Salmon
Can I make this recipe in advance?
Absolutely! One of the fantastic things about Caribbean Coconut Curry Salmon is that it actually tastes even better when allowed to marinate. You can prepare the entire dish a day ahead, allowing the flavors to meld beautifully. Store it in an airtight container in the refrigerator, and simply reheat it when you’re ready to serve. For optimal taste, gently warm it on the stove rather than microwave it, which can overcook the salmon.
What can I use as a substitute for coconut milk?
If you find yourself out of coconut milk or would prefer a lighter option, don’t worry! You can substitute it with almond milk or oat milk. For a more similar flavor, use a combination of unsweetened almond milk and a bit of coconut extract to mimic that tropical essence. That way, your Caribbean Coconut Curry Salmon still retains the comforting and creamy texture that makes it so special.
How spicy is this dish with the scotch bonnet pepper?
Scotch bonnet peppers are known for their intensity, so the heat level can vary widely depending on your tolerance. If you enjoy a milder curry, consider using just half of the pepper or removing the seeds, where most of the heat resides. For heat-loving foodies, keeping the whole pepper will deliver that authentic Caribbean kick! Remember, you can always add more spice later, but it’s hard to take it away once it’s in there.

PrintCaribbean Coconut Curry Salmon: A Healthy, Flavorful Delight
Delight your taste buds with this Caribbean Coconut Curry Salmon recipe, combining rich flavors and healthy ingredients.
- Prep Time: 10 minutes
- Cook Time: 15 minutes
- Total Time: 25 minutes
- Yield: 2 servings 1x
- Category: Main Dish
- Method: Stovetop
- Cuisine: Caribbean
- Diet: Gluten-Free
Ingredients
- 2 salmon fillets
- 1 can (14 oz) coconut milk
- 2 tablespoons curry powder
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- 1 onion, chopped
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 bell pepper, chopped
- 1 teaspoon salt
- 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
- 1 tablespoon lime juice
Instructions
- Heat olive oil in a skillet over medium heat.
- Add onion and cook until translucent.
- Stir in garlic and bell pepper, cooking for another 2-3 minutes.
- Add curry powder, stirring well to combine.
- Pour in coconut milk and bring to a simmer.
- Season with salt, black pepper, and lime juice.
- Add salmon fillets and cook for about 5-7 minutes until salmon is cooked through.
- Serve hot, garnished with fresh herbs.
Notes
- This dish pairs well with rice or quinoa.
- Ensure the salmon is fresh for the best flavor.
